China Advanced Research Reactor (CARR), a cooled and moderated by light water, reflected by heavy water, inverse neutron trap reactor, is being constructed in China Institute of Atomic Energy in 21st Century. High flux neutron can be educed from the core, so CARR can meet the need of preceding basic research, e.g. neutron scattering experiment, and the need of the nuclear industry, national defense, and Country economy. The main technical indexes of CARR can attain the advanced level in the world.The ventilation and air-conditional supervising and control system is an important part of the reactor supervising and control system. The ventilation and air-conditional system that be supervised and controlled is used to filtrate the radioactivity discharged air, so it's crucial to the environment safety. By manual/automatic control the ventilators and intakes, the supervising and control system achieve manual/automatic control to the reactor building and supervision of every facility's running state.The ventilation and air-conditional supervising and control system is a distributed control system. It used Quantum series PLC to supervise and control and communicate with the servers by fiber network. The servers storage data and run the database. The operator stations run the Human-Machine Interface picture to achieve real time control.The ventilation and air-conditional supervising and control system of CARR adopts totally digital supervision and control, it's the first time to be used in research reactor in our country. It ensures its stability and reliability by choosing high quality hardware and software and adopting proper redundancy method. It has friendly Human-Machine Interface and adopts proper security method, so all these will make operation safer and more reliable and relieve labour intensities.The ventilation and air-conditional supervising and control system of CARR found a solid basis for the future stable operation of CARR, and the implementation of the system promotes the application of digital control technology in reactors in China.
